would a wash improve the figures??
Nice work Nosher
Its always hard to tell with washes when looking at photos
I am sure I have commented before on this site and others that such and such figure would look better with a brown wash only it had already been done but the camera flash had ( pardon the pun) washed the photo out
They look good to me.
As you have left black bits as shadows, I don't think a wash will make much difference, and may blend in the highlighting you have done too much.
I'd get the basing done and then see whether they need a wash or not. Sometimes a wash can dull them down a bit too much IMHO.
Look good. ;)
Wouldn't worry about how they photograph; naked eye is how you and everyone else will see them. I almost think there's a "style" of painting for photography (which mine just doesn't suit).
